FeAgSe₂ is an iron-silver selenide compound belonging to the semiconductor family, characterized by mixed-metal chalcogenide chemistry. This material is primarily of research interest for thermoelectric and photovoltaic applications, where its layered crystal structure and variable electronic properties offer potential advantages in energy conversion devices. While not yet widely commercialized, FeAgSe₂ represents an emerging class of multinary semiconductors being investigated as alternatives to conventional materials in niche applications requiring enhanced thermal or electronic performance at moderate temperatures.
